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4048105 39133197 12800 045208252 88
520726248 83153147
520726248 83153147
830606155 121474798 94
All about undefined
Interested in learning more?
520726248 83153147
830606155 121474798 94
See more
98367124328 760
962 01 47633 2822748872
See more
84082242974 73090
66825 6642 0930278 1554 349922
See more